The cheapest way to get from Dollar to Portpatrick is to bus which costs £18 - £27 and takes 5h 58m.
The fastest way to get from Dollar to Portpatrick is to drive which takes 2h 32m and costs £30 - £50.
No, there is no direct bus from Dollar to Portpatrick. However, there are services departing from Mitchell Court and arriving at Post Office via North Approach Road, Buchanan Bus Station and Port Rodie.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 5h 58m.
The distance between Dollar and Portpatrick is 133 miles. The road distance is 127.4 miles.
The best way to get from Dollar to Portpatrick without a car is to bus which takes 5h 58m and costs £18 - £27.
It takes approximately 5h 58m to get from Dollar to Portpatrick, including transfers.
Dollar to Portpatrick bus services, operated by Stagecoach East Scotland, depart from North Approach Road station.
The best way to get from Dollar to Portpatrick is to bus which takes 5h 58m and costs £18 - £27. Alternatively, you can train, which costs £30 - £45 and takes 6h 36m.
Dollar to Portpatrick bus services, operated by Stagecoach East Scotland, arrive at Buchanan Bus Station.
Yes, the driving distance between Dollar to Portpatrick is 127 miles. It takes approximately 2h 32m to drive from Dollar to Portpatrick.
